Positively the best Vinho Verde I’ve tasted - not that I’d drink it often.
Very expressive nose of green apple, unripe start fruit, peach, lemon, chalk, and green vegetables. The palate is supple and nicely textured yet very lively, with high tone yet round acidity. Long finish with hint of sea breeze. Unique but unmistakably Vinho Verde.
The vineyard is located in Monção boarding Spain.
